The Making of: Juggernaut (Dota)

The Manila Major is here and to celebrate that I thought to make some Dota related beadsprites. I decided to keep it simple this time and go with a ready sprite. Hero minimap icons' size was good for what I had in mind and I made Juggernaut. Here is how it turned out:

 Easiest colour i.e. black first.


Next Photo Pearls (PP) Red (19) and Hama Dark grey (71).


PP orange (13) and Hama Pink (06). I hadn't noticed before that there was pink in Juggernaut's mask. Well of course the minimap  icon is so small that you can't really see it.First I tried PP Pink (25) but it was way too bright.


Hama Grey (17) and Light grey (70).


Another surprise was that the mask is not actually white but kind of really really light shade of green. I used PP Light grey (10) because it was the closest almost white I have. There also is some PP Light beiges (12) near the... ears or what ever those are.


Then the browns. These browns (PP 02, 03 and Hama 12) were too dark so I changed them for lighter.


The browns are PP Brown 27, Light brown20 and Cappuccino 06. I also replaced some beads with Hama Grey and Light grey (around the ear area).


Top part finished with Hama Burgundy (30), Reddish brown (20), Light brown (21) and PP Rust (05)


Finished Juggernaut on the wall waiting for company. It turned out pretty great.
